1What is a realistic budget range for a full bathroom remodel in Gilliam, Missouri?

For a full remodel in our area, including labor and materials, homeowners can expect a range of $10,000 to $25,000, with the final cost heavily dependent on the size of the bathroom and your selections. Mid-range fixtures and finishes are typical, and it's wise to budget an additional 10-15% for unforeseen issues common in older homes in Gilliam, like updating plumbing or addressing subfloor rot. Local material costs are generally in line with regional Midwest averages, but transportation fees can slightly increase prices for specialty items.

2How does Gilliam's climate and seasonal weather affect the remodeling timeline?

Missouri's humid summers and cold winters directly impact project scheduling. The high humidity in summer can affect drying times for drywall mud and paint, potentially extending the schedule. Most contractors and homeowners prefer spring or fall projects to avoid temperature extremes, but indoor work can proceed year-round. A key local consideration is ensuring your contractor properly seals and insulates any exterior walls to prevent moisture intrusion and improve energy efficiency against our variable climate.

5My home in Gilliam is older. What are common hidden issues found during a bathroom renovation here?

In Gilliam's historic homes, common surprises include outdated galvanized plumbing that needs full replacement, insufficient or damaged subflooring from long-term moisture, and the presence of asbestos or lead-based materials in flooring or wall coverings. Additionally, walls may lack modern moisture-resistant barriers. A thorough inspection by your contractor before finalizing a quote is essential to identify and budget for these potential issues, preventing major cost overruns mid-project.
